On 8/28/2020 at 4:22 PM, gardenbunny said:

That new $5 rapid test  announced yesterday by Abbott with results in 15 mintues and 97% accurate sounds like a game changer.  And the ability to produce 50 million a month is huge.  It is exactly  what is needed to get every part of society moving ahead again.  

 

However, this Abbot fast test announced this week and which has caused such optimism is great for determining if people who already shows symptoms have Covid-19 or not. No information given on tests with people who do not currently present symptoms.

 

per  https://abbott.mediaroom.com/2020-08-26-Abbotts-Fast-5-15-Minute-Easy-to-Use-COVID-19-Antigen-Test-Receives-FDA-Emergency-Use-Authorization-Mobile-App-Displays-Test-Results-to-Help-Our-Return-to-Daily-Life-Ramping-Production-to-50-Million-Tests-a-Month

 

"demonstrated sensitivity of 97.1% (positive percent agreement) and specificity of 98.5% (negative percent agreement) in patients suspected of COVID-19 by their healthcare provider within the first seven days of symptom onset."

 

"It is intended for the qualitative detection of nucleocapsid protein antigen from SARS-CoV-2 in nasal swabs from individuals suspected of COVID-19 by their healthcare provider within the first seven days of symptom onset."

 

Of course the ideal is to get accurate testing for those who do not have any symptoms which includes people who are two days away from experiencing symptoms and those who will never present symptoms, both of which can spread the virus to others.
